Soulja Boy was one of the most prominent rappers in the 2000s. Known for hits such as Crank That, Kiss Me Through the Phone, and Pretty Boy Swag, Soulja Boy has virtually disappeared from the scene for the past few years. However, the release of the TikTok-ready track She Make It Clap put Soulja Boy back in the spotlight.

What made the rapper’s new song immensely popular is its accompanying dance challenge, which is incredibly simple to recreate. All you have to do is clap in the air in three different spots, punch the air in three different spots, and do the “Superman” dance that Soulja Boy popularized all the way back in 2007.
